Hyper-infused music duo, The Ting Tings, have been on somewhat of a hiatus since releasing their debut album, We Started Nothing, nearly four years ago. Devoted to their craft however, Jules de Martino and Katie White have been seen touring around the world, sharing time in the studio creating a followup to their 2008 successful release, Sounds from Nowhereville. Hypetrak had the recent pleasure of chopping it up with the duo, discussing the creation of their latest album, why the original followup production was shelved, their experiences with Cypress Hill on the road, and much more. The Ting Tings’ sophomore album released this week in the UK and will be available in the U.S. on March 15.
